This Notice of Intent to Lien form can be downloaded and used to help speed up payment on a construction project in ia.
Even though sending a Notice of Intent to Lien is an optional (not required) step in the state of ia, they are frequently successful at producing payment (without having to take the next step of filing a lien). If a party is refusing to pay your claim or ignoring your phone calls, sending a Notice of Intent to Lien to that party, the prime contractor and/or the property owner can let them know you’re serious about collecting and prioritize your payment. No one wants to be forced to file a mechanics lien, and this document gives all of the parties involved one final chance to take care of the payment issues on a project.
This form advises the party that a lien will be filed if payment is not received within 10 days.
Since this is a non required document, you can deliver it electronically, or via mail. Sendinging documents via certified mail always adds another layer of professionalism to your payment practices.
